PETTY
PETTY is a Texas oil lease in Nolan County, Railroad Commission district 7B, operated by Union Pacific Resources Company.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from November 1995 to October 1998, totalling 6,645 barrels. The lease is not currently producing. Its strongest month on the record we hold was December 1995, at 2,543 barrels.
